I am a little late to the discussion, but here is what I think about the new bikes that Harley Decided to release recently. They are attempting to attract a younger market as their older customers are fading away. This is a good thing. But they are going about it all wrong. Most millennials don't have the extra money to spend on a bike that costs as much as a car! Especially when the bikes are stuck in the dark ages. You have to improve and adapt to survive. It looks like Harley either doesn't want to, or for some reason cant! Even those of us than can afford them, don't want them! They have lackluster performance, way too much weight, and a lack of basic features that you can get on beginner bikes. If they want to survive and thrive, they need to start getting some of those to market. No more detuning engines for a cool sound. No more $20k bikes without any features, no more using the heaviest materials available just to look cool. Also, no more revealing a new line of bikes, that are just as disappointing as the bikes they are made to replace! I am scared for the company.
